Why can’t I search in a PDF file?

The main reason that normally causes this is because the pdf is created from a scanned image. That means, there is no text to search (and nothing you can do about it using the free Reader software). Using the select tool, try selecting a word in the text. If you can’t do it, it’s a scan.

How do I repair Acrobat Reader?

Repair Reader or Acrobat (Reader) Choose Help > Repair Adobe Reader Installation. (Acrobat) Choose Help > Repair Acrobat Installation.

How do I make a PDF searchable in Adobe?

Turn paper documents into searchable PDFs In the right hand pane, select the Enhance Scans tool. Select Enhance > Camera Image to bring up the Enhance sub menu. Select the correct option from the Content drop down. Auto Detect is the default and works on most scanned documents.

How do you do a search in a PDF?

How to search for a word in a PDF using any PDF reader Open any PDF with your default PDF reader. Press CTRL+F (Windows) or CMD+F (Mac). In the text box, enter your search term. The first match will be highlighted. Press Enter or click the right arrow to navigate between the results.

How do I know if I have iFilter installed?

You should check if you have the PDF iFilter installed and to do so you need to go to Control Panel > Indexing Options > Advanced Options > File Types and then check what it says next to PDF extension, if you see that it says “PDF Filter” then it means you have the filter already installed.

What is PDF iFilter?

Adobe® PDF iFilter is designed for end users or administrators who wish to index Adobe PDF documents using Microsoft indexing clients. This allows the user to easily search for text within Adobe PDF documents. Simply use Acrobat to build a Catalog index for the PDF files of interest.

How do I stop Adobe from crashing?

Acrobat DC crashes intermittently on Windows. Solution 1: Update Acrobat DC to the latest version. Solution 2: Run Repair Acrobat Installation while no other applications are running. Solution 3: Turn off protected view. Solution 4: Launch Distiller DC and check if Acrobat DC is activated.

Is Adobe Acrobat still supported?

As stated in the Adobe Support Lifecycle Policy, Adobe provides five years of product support, starting from the general availability date of Adobe Reader and Adobe Acrobat. In line with this policy, support for Adobe Acrobat Classic 2015 and Adobe Acrobat Reader Classic 2015 ends on April 07, 2020.
